I have seen Charlotte waiting for a bus many times. She is in her 80s. She is small and thin. She lives in a nursing home near my home. I have got to know her as I stop and give her a lift any time I see her. Even if I am going in the opposite direction or I have just been out for a pint of milk, I still give her a lift.
Charlotte looks elderly and weak but last time I gave her a lift she told me she’d been on a helicopter ride even showing photos to prove it! She had gone with her daughter and granddaughter and she looked as if she enjoyed the whole experience! I told her she was braver than I was! I also loved to do that in this technological age, and her family were considerate enough to print the photos out for Charlotte.
I met her recently in Lisburn town center where we both live. She was sitting on a bench with a few items of shopping. I asked her if I could give her a lift home, though she didn’t recognize me, as I was out of context for her - that is, I was not in my car. She explained she was going to visit the elderly in a nearby home. She thanked me for my offer but did not want to take me out of my way and was happy to take a bus as she usually do when going there. I told her it was my pleasure and planned to meet her a few minutes later when I had picked up my shopping. Charlotte happily agreed. I picked her up and dropped her off at the home. She told me someone else usually brought her home.
Charlotte might look like a thin weak old lady in her 80s but I can see through that, she’s young at heart, she can soar high into the sky and at the same time she’s grounded enough to visit “the elderly” who may need a visit, company and a friendly face.
When I grow up I want to be as young as Charlotte.
